- Boston Marathon, the world's oldest annual marathon attracting elite runners and thousands of spectators
- Boston Calling Music Festival, a three-day music festival featuring top artists across various genres
- Independence Day Celebration on the Esplanade, a spectacular fireworks display and concert celebrating America's birthday along the Charles River.
- Best sights: Freedom Trail, a 2.5-mile-long path through downtown Boston that passes by 16 significant historical sites
- Fenway Park, the iconic baseball stadium and home of the Boston Red Sox
- Museum of Fine Arts, one of the largest art museums in the United States with an extensive collection of artworks
- Boston Common, the oldest public park in the United States offering green space and historical landmarks
- New England Aquarium, a popular attraction featuring a wide variety of marine life and interactive exhibits.
- Patriot's Day, commemorates the start of the American Revolution with reenactments and parades
- Memorial Day, marks the unofficial start of summer with vibrant outdoor activities and events
- Labor Day, offers pleasant weather and a chance to enjoy the city's parks and waterfront.
- Things to do: Explore the historic streets of Beacon Hill, known for its charming cobblestone streets and Federal-style rowhouses
- Take a scenic walk along the Charles River Esplanade, offering beautiful views of the Boston skyline
- Visit the Boston Public Library, a stunning architectural landmark with impressive collections and exhibits
- Enjoy a guided tour of the historic USS Constitution, the world's oldest commissioned naval vessel still afloat
- Discover the vibrant atmosphere of Quincy Market, with its diverse food stalls and unique shops.
